The project in detail.
Hepburn Architects developed a contemporary extension and remodelling strategy for this substantial detached property in Calthorpe, Birmingham.
The design introduces a striking two-storey side extension incorporating an integrated garage and a fully glazed feature gable. Vertical timber cladding adds warmth and texture, while dark grey metalwork and contemporary window frames create a strong architectural contrast.
Across the main elevation, the ground floor has been unified through a carefully composed palette of natural stone, dark vertical cladding and expansive glazing. The revised entrance is clearly defined within the new façade, creating a stronger sense of arrival and improving the overall balance of the property.
The result is a cohesive contemporary family home that retains the familiar form of the original building while introducing modern detailing, improved internal accommodation and a more confident architectural identity.
